titleOfInvention |
Targeted delivery of compounds using multimerization technology |
abstract |
There is disclosed herein subunits and multimers of subunits suitable for use in inducing the transport of one or more cargo substances into a cell and in some instances across a cell. The subunits may have a targeting domain such as an antibody or antibody fragment, a multimerization domain, such as a verotoxin B-subunit mutant scaffold, and a cargo molecule such as a drug or imaging agent, which may be directly linked to the subunit or may be packaged in a liposome, nanoparticle, or the like. In some instances the targeting domain may have affinity for a blood-brain barrier antigen and may be capable of inducing cell mediated transcytosis to facilitate delivery of the cargo molecule across the blood-brain barrier. In some instances the targeting region may have affinity for a cancer antigen and may be capable of inducing cell-mediated endocytosis. |
